Output 521c9564e435724a9ea60c3b0cfc9842e2d5ee8828407738ac89db05e6e6f597:1

value
31584550
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 35d5152bbfdcd26779da1cca3e2714ba37c70ddb OP_EQUALVERIFY OP_CHECKSIG
address
15ue5QvaeNhqfapeqYFXh2q1Csu2ZFTZPR
transaction
521c9564e435724a9ea60c3b0cfc9842e2d5ee8828407738ac89db05e6e6f597
spent
true